The Ways of the Soul, An Underground River
The River of Gold Lighting the Hills
 
Deep in the innermost recesses of your being are the words waiting to give you the guidance sought by the conscious mind. It is not for that mind to do the leading, but for it to walk hand in hand with the God-self, whereupon the soul's true direction lies. With this accord, then, Self is the true guide and Self puts at rest, at ease, any doubt or discomfort about the path, its direction and its walking.

Listen to the sounds of the heart to find this voice, that self-same which you have listened to for so long and have heeded on your path to healing. Know that the song of the heart is the song of God, and it manifests in the life of all beings simply through things that we see, things we love and all that conspires to bring us what is right and holy in our lives.

 

Beloved, the Father sends upon thee the grace poured from legions beyond and from thine own inner self out to others. Know that what is given to thee and what pours from thee is the same grace and only empowers all. Once a child of God is in this flow, no thing can interrupt it, neither time nor space nor thoughts of another.

But thoughts of self--doubt, despair, fear, sorrow--these thoughts may undermine the flow, stagnate the waters and cause separation from the strength and power of the river. The lesson continues: fear and judgment do strangle what self is meant to do, and not a moment in time is it necessary to spend in this way. Below the forest floor is an underground stream, and in that stream are the minerals which feed the entire forest. Can we know the strength and power in those minerals without tasting it? But do we profit from them without the taste?

Even as the stream feeds the forest, and the minerals make whole that which grows within it, so does the soul's destiny empower each person and feed the direction taken by Soul. One cannot tap dry the underground spring, nor belie the soul's power, no more can All That Is become no-thing. So be at peace with the process that goes on without conscious knowledge. It is thy stream, and it is driven by thee. It does feed the forest, and even the tiny birds which take refuge there. They are the little pleasures in life, that which awakens us to our powers and gifts and which gives us reason to sleep, satisfied, at night after our work is done.

They do not need to distract, nor will they alight here without cause or reason. For all is connected in the Father's kingdom, brushed with the Light of Love and Healing, strengthened by Faith and Hope, built on belief and the knowledge of the Soul that all is of its own will and making.

Seek only peace and these answers will prove themselves in life, today and always.

Q. Shall I make plans to foster the soul's work?

A. It is not necessary for this to be done, as Soul has its own plan and works in accord with time and space, in ways unknown to the conscious mind. It is enough for one--anyone--to be steeped in prayer and meditation, and to listen for soul's direction at all times, in the form of urges, guidance, dreams and calls to this or that.

Hear this and you work in close accord with soul, not setting goals or formulating desire which would get in the way of the Higher wisdom and knowledge.

This does not keep thee, however, from carrying out what is felt to be the heart's desire, as heart and soul flow in accord with one another, as inseparable as the wave which turns in upon itself as a crest. So follow the heart, and you follow the urging of the soul. In following both, thou art in accord with the dreams of the Father and the soul's longing for itself.

Q: Do I not need to write down what I/my heart wants to do, so that there becomes room for these to manifest?

A. Be at peace with the process and be guided by the opening of doors within thine own life. Behind these doors lie the goals thou wouldst achieve
--the book of the soul, the dream of living in mountains and sea, the hope of speaking out for the Father, and the desire to help others walk through the paths thou hast blazed for them. All of these things lie before thee and all await due time for their blossoming.

Be at peace, beloved, and only place the mind and heart upon these clear desires. Love the Father, love self, love others sent to thee for growth and healing and empowerment. This is thy work--to work in service to God, self and neighbor. It can be done in no way other than by tasting the minerals in the underground river.

Enjoy the birdsong. Walk free and feel the wind. Sing songs of joy and praise. And worry not about the time to come. It awaits thee in a paradise of color, light and sound heralding the beauty and joy long promised thee for this hard work, which thou hast been doing and are doing now, even in this writing.

Learn the way--calm, peace and love. There is no other. Live in the moment and be free to enjoy what is now.

The soul, like an underground river, feeds now and tomorrow. It opens the doors, and does the work waiting to be done. Peace be with you.
